U.S. strikes Iran again as lawmakers react to Driscoll

Filed: Sep 01, 2026 at 8:00 PM ET
Summary: U.S. forces carried out strikes against Iran on Tuesday, the second series of attacks in three days. The report also says lawmakers reacted to the resignation of U.S. Army Secretary Dan Driscoll, part of an early-departure wave among senior U.S. military leadership.
WHO: U.S. forces; lawmakers; Dan Driscoll
WHAT: U.S. forces conducted a second series of strikes against Iran in three days, while lawmakers reacted to the resignation of U.S. Army Secretary Dan Driscoll.
WHEN: Sep 01, 2026
WHERE: Iran
WHY: The strikes were a response within a short sequence of U.S.-Iran attacks over three days.
